6 What is CSE? Child Sexual Exploitation ‘ Someone taking advantage of you sexually, for their own benefit. Through threats, bribes, violence, humiliation or by telling you that they love you, they will have the power to get you to do sexual things for their own or other people’s enjoyment.’

8 Models of CSE A.Party model B.Grooming/befriending C.Boyfriend/pimp D.Peer on peer E.Organised trafficking 1. Victims are moved through gangs of (usually) men between towns and coerced into sex. 2. Use of inappropriate power over victim, friendship starts. 3. Gatherings are organised with lots of drink and drugs. 4. A seemingly consensual relationship develops but turns abusive. 5. Someone of the same age. Can you match the model to the description?
